Samsung NX210 vs Sony A35 Overview

Below is a in-depth review of the Samsung NX210 versus Sony A35, former being a Entry-Level Mirrorless while the latter is a Entry-Level DSLR by rivals Samsung and Sony. There is a sizable difference between the image resolutions of the NX210 (20MP) and A35 (16MP) but they feature the same exact sensor sizing (APS-C).

The NX210 was announced 11 months later than the A35 which means that they are both of a similar age. Each of the cameras offer different body type with the Samsung NX210 being a Rangefinder-style mirrorless camera and the Sony A35 being a Compact SLR camera.

Samsung NX210 vs Sony A35 Physical Comparison

For those who are planning to lug around your camera frequently, you're going to have to take into account its weight and volume. The Samsung NX210 enjoys external measurements of 117mm x 63mm x 37mm (4.6" x 2.5" x 1.5") with a weight of 222 grams (0.49 lbs) while the Sony A35 has sizing of 124mm x 92mm x 85mm (4.9" x 3.6" x 3.3") along with a weight of 415 grams (0.91 lbs).

Samsung NX210 vs Sony A35 Sensor Comparison

Generally, it can be hard to envision the gap between sensor measurements merely by reading a spec sheet. The visual underneath may provide you a stronger sense of the sensor measurements in the NX210 and A35.

As you can see, both the cameras enjoy the same exact sensor sizing albeit not the same resolution. You can count on the Samsung NX210 to deliver greater detail with its extra 4 Megapixels. Higher resolution can also make it easier to crop shots far more aggressively. The more recent NX210 is going to have an advantage in sensor tech.
